Ru-Board.club
← Вернуться в раздел «Microsoft Windows»

» Автоматическая (unattended) установка Windows

Автор: michz
Дата сообщения: 13.03.2006 09:05
igmisem
"WinXP Home (португальская версия)" - гм, а ты пробывал стандартные способы MS по дополнительной языковой поддержке

Добавлено:
Charykov
"Курс молодого бойца" Класса - поищи
Автор: squid
Дата сообщения: 19.03.2006 21:10
возможно ли как то в процессе инсталяции привязать имя компа к маку
или хотя бі назначит имя компа как мак ?
Автор: dyr farot
Дата сообщения: 20.03.2006 10:27
к какому еще маку привязать?
Автор: KapralBel
Дата сообщения: 20.03.2006 11:38
dyr farot
MAC - в общем, аппаратный адрес (уникальный номер) сетевой карты
Автор: dyr farot
Дата сообщения: 20.03.2006 11:45
тогда с какого перепугу к ниму должно имя компа привязываться?
IP-шник -- можно привязать, но имя компа...
я такого и в винде не видел.
Автор: RussianNeuroMancer
Дата сообщения: 20.03.2006 14:27
Прикинь: Ты админишь комп.класс, делаешь инсталляху Винды специально для этого класса. Нужно шоб Винда после установки автоматом меняла сетевое имя в зависимости от мака (должна быть таблица соответствия). Таким образом даже после реинсталла с форматированием имя будет правильное.
Моя идея: пишем либо прогу, либо скрипт (в "Автоматизации администрирования" должны помочь).

Добавлено:
Ну и поставить эту программу или скрипт в однократное выполнение после установки.
Скуид, решишь проблему выложи решение здесь или в пм. Я сейчас перечитал свой пост и понял что мне это тоже нужно :)
Автор: squid
Дата сообщения: 20.03.2006 14:47
RussianNeuroMancer
спасибо, хоть какой то реальный вариант решения
Автор: squid
Дата сообщения: 20.03.2006 22:52
RussianNeuroMancer
конечно не по маку, но в начале инсталяции указать имя компа нашел как

Цитата:
Файл автоматизированной установки содержит часть настроек установки, применимых для использования на всех машинах, и часть уникальных (имя пользователя, имя компьютера, адрес TCP/IP и т.д.). Уникальные настройки могут быть выполнены в виде отдельного текстового файла определенного формата, содержащего различные секции для каждого компьютера. Это так называемый текстовый UDF файл. Формат использования: /UDF:ID[,<database file name>]. Пример UDF файла:

[UniqueIds]
u1 = UserData,TCPIPParams
u2 = UserData,TCPIPParams
[u1:UserData]
FullName = "Andrey Harchenko"
ComputerName = perviy
ProductID = xxx-xxxxxx
[u1:TCPIPParams]
IPAddress = 200.200.153.45
[u2:UserData]
FullName = "Andrey Harchenko"
ComputerName = vtoroy
ProductID = xxx-xxxxxx
[u2:TCPIPParams]
IPAddress = 200.200.153.46

ID определен, в нашем случае, u1 или u2. Если приведенный выше файл сохранен как udf.txt, то для автоматизированной установки на машину номер один, нужно использовать:
winnt /b /s:z: /u:unattend.txt /UDF:u1,udf.txt
Произойдет установка пользователя Andrey Harchenko на компьютер "perviy" c IP адресом 200.200.153.45. Параметр /b означает установку без создания загрузочных дискет, параметр /s устанавливает путь к дистрибутиву (например, z://nt/dist) и т.д.


если конечно использовать RIS там точно есть по маку, недавно шарился в настройках видел там такую фишку


Добавлено:
путь к файлу udf.txt желательно указывать полностью, там где он находится
Автор: alin
Дата сообщения: 25.03.2006 21:55
Подскажите, пожалуйста, как можно провести автоматическую установку Windows XP, используя не флопик, а flash-накопитель? Файл ответов, который создаётся при помощи утилитки входящий в дистрибутив Windows XP, я обычно копировал на дискетку и далее проводил установку системы. При попытки установить с flash-накопителя такой номер не проходит…
Автор: Veduchii
Дата сообщения: 03.04.2006 23:06
Есть параметр - UnattendSwitch="yes", указывающий программе установки пропустить шаг "Добро Пожаловать в Windows" или Мини-установку. Установите параметр в "yes", если вы хотите пропустить экраны "Настройка подключения к Интернет" и "Создание учетной записи".

Теперь вопрос, - как пропустить экран "Настройка подключения к Интернет" и в тоже время оставить при установке параметр "Создание учетной записи". Ибо пользователи разные и забивать одно имя в cmdlines.txt не хочу... Что-то решения я не нашел на форуме...
Автор: nick444
Дата сообщения: 13.04.2006 13:54
Сложно найти тему под мой вопрос, так что если напутал - извините.
А дело вот в чем: мне нужно поставить 2000 винду, при нынешнем ХР(не случалось ставить). Возможно ли установить 2000, но чтобы при этом можно было работать в ХР.
Т.е. при включении питания меня спросят, что загружать?
(Тока не смейтесь над вопросом- он уж больно ламерский.)
Автор: dyr farot
Дата сообщения: 13.04.2006 14:04
вторую винду давно уже ставил, но насколько я помню винда это делает автоматом -- только на другой раздел вторую систему ставь
и вот:
http://forum.ixbt.com/topic.cgi?id=67:60
Автор: nick444
Дата сообщения: 13.04.2006 14:23

Цитата:
только на другой раздел вторую систему ставь

На другой логический диск? И ставить из ХР или как-то иначе?
Автор: dyr farot
Дата сообщения: 13.04.2006 14:33
ну да. он же partition
можно и из нее, но лучше загрузится с компакта ( во избежание )
Автор: prived
Дата сообщения: 13.04.2006 14:52
В дистре для Мак нашел такой параметр:
[Data]
UseBIOSToBoot=1
Вроде в оригинальной ХР не встречался...
Автор: PaRaDiSe
Дата сообщения: 13.04.2006 17:13
nick444

Цитата:
мне нужно поставить 2000 винду, при нынешнем ХР(не случалось ставить). Возможно ли установить 2000, но чтобы при этом можно было работать в ХР.

Вопрос как раз по месту. У меня на некоторых машинах по 3-4 винды стояло(так было нужно).

dyr farot
Не путай человека. Все прекрасно встанет на один раздел. Нужно в файле ответов указать системные каталоги для W2k, отличные от WXP.

Делаем например так:

[Data]
AutoPartition=0
MsDosInitiated="0"
UnattendedInstall="Yes"

[GuiUnattended]
ProfilesDir="%SYSTEMDRIVE%\Documents & Settings.W2K"
OEMSkipWelcome=1

[Unattended]
FileSystem=*
UnattendSwitch=Yes
ProgramFilesDir=\PROGRAMS.W2K
CommonProgramFilesDir="\PROGRAMS.W2K\Common Files"
TargetPath=WIN_2K
OEMSkipEula=Yes
UnattendMode=ProvideDefault
OemPreinstall=No

[UserData]
ProductKey=...

[RegionalSettings]
LanguageGroup=5,1
SystemLocale=00000419
UserLocale=00000419
InputLocale=0409:00000409,0419:00000419

Не забываем подставить свой ProductKey в формате XXXXX-XXXXX-XXXXX-XXXXX-XXXX
Автор: gryu
Дата сообщения: 13.04.2006 21:37
PaRaDiSe
Слушай, а системную папку "RECYCLER" другую можно прописать?
А то в твоём случае всё ОК, но каждый раз будет ругатся на формат корзины. "типа не правельный!!". Не критично, но неприятно.
Да и "System Volume Information" тоже изменить бы... ????
Автор: dyr farot
Дата сообщения: 14.04.2006 10:56
я не пугаю, я просто облегчаю жизнь. потому как встать то оно встанет, а потом косяки как посыпятся...

корзину можно в реестре переименовать:
Windows 9.x/Me/NT/2000:
HKEY_CLASSES_ROOT --> CLSID --> {645FF040-5081-101B-9F08-00AA002F954E}
Windows XP:
HKEY_CURRENT_USER --> Software --> Microsoft --> Windows --> CurrentVersion --> Explorer --> CLSID --> {645FF040-5081-101B-9F08-00AA002F954E}
а вот "System Volume Information" вряд ли получится -- это hard-coded прибамбас системы.

это одна из причин, но которой рекомендуется разные системы ставить на разные разделы ( тем более с помощью Partition Magic' а добавить еще один раздел -- задача нескольких минут )
Автор: SFC
Дата сообщения: 15.04.2006 21:37
А не пытался ли кто-ньть созда - вать версию виндовс с интегрированными всеми текущими обновлениями (и скажем обновлять эту версию раз в месяц) чтобы можно было устанавливать единожды и без мучений
Автор: MrTroll
Дата сообщения: 15.04.2006 23:18
Имею такую сборку: Microsoft.Windows.XP.Professional.Corporate.SP2.Integrated.February.2006.MULTI.IMAGE-ETH0
в ней интегрированные патчи в папке i386/svcpack имеют ввид KBхххххх.ca_, в файле SVCPACK.INI имеем:
[ProductCatalogsToInstall]
KB319740.cat
KB870981.cat
KB873339.cat
KB883523.cat
KB884538.cat
KB884575.cat
.....
т.е. без всяких дополнительных ключей /Q /O /N /Z
папки $OEM$, $OEM$\$1, $$ и так далее отсутствуют.
Внимание вопрос!
Как в можно в таком же формате интегрировать патчи самостоятельно ???
XPCREATE и nLite пробовал, не получается.
Автор: MCSASE
Дата сообщения: 17.04.2006 06:54
SFC
У меня имеется такая сборка. Интергрирую все обновления для Win2kSp4 и WinXPSp2.
Обновления беру со WSUS. А в чем собственно вопрос?

Добавлено:
MrTroll

Цитата:
в файле SVCPACK.INI имеем:

Только файл имеет расширение INF.
Если все так, как ты описал, то
у тебя должен быть каталг svcpack, в котором лежат сами cat файлы и exe файлы обновлений. Так вот exe файлы можно взять и итегрировать руками в другой дистриб.
Автор: SFC
Дата сообщения: 17.04.2006 08:54
MCSASE
Просто думаю сделать себе такую же и интересовался принципиальной возможностью
Автор: Klesk
Дата сообщения: 17.04.2006 15:55
MCSASE
Можешь подробно описать процесс интегрирования патчей? Если не сложно то без ссылок на сторонние сайты в свое время лазил - такая муть, ниче непонятно.
Автор: MrTroll
Дата сообщения: 17.04.2006 23:27
MCSASE
Да да, рассширение INF НО все же. В папке svcpack ни каких ехе нет, ни как при интеграции вручную.
Автор: Sish
Дата сообщения: 18.04.2006 05:01
Klesk

Цитата:
Можешь подробно описать процесс интегрирования патчей?

Создаёшь командник вида
Код: @Echo Off
.......
<имя файла обновления> /integrate:<полный путь к дистру>
.......
Автор: RussianNeuroMancer
Дата сообщения: 18.04.2006 05:11
Или юзаешь nLite.
Автор: MCSASE
Дата сообщения: 18.04.2006 06:09
Klesk
Вот здесь все подробнейшим и доступным образом объяснено
http://oszone.net/display.php?id=2747

Sish
Ну на самом деле не совсем так. Не все обновления поддерживают ключ /integrate

MrTroll

Странно все это. А как обновления интегрировались в дистриб?
Автор: Sish
Дата сообщения: 18.04.2006 06:16
MCSASE

Цитата:
Не все обновления поддерживают ключ /integrate

Согласен, более ранние (приблизительно до марта 2004-го) не поддерживают.
Автор: Klesk
Дата сообщения: 18.04.2006 08:28
MCSASE
Согласен, не поддерживают, почему и написал здесь свой пост с просьбой написать поподробнее.
Автор: AlexEuro
Дата сообщения: 19.04.2006 03:23
Подскажите каким образом можно создать дистрибутив Windows XP со встроеннымы программами. Подскажите как сделать пакеты автоматической установки программ. Для примера Winamp и office 2003

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263

Предыдущая тема: Windows XP


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.